Blue Cross Blue Shield of Massachusetts is consistently recognized as one of the nation's best health plans for member satisfaction and quality. As a locally based, not-for-profit company serving Massachusetts for more than 80 years, we're also proud of the recognition we've received for our community involvement and our leadership in promoting diverse, healthy and environmentally-friendly workplaces.
Quality & Customer Service
Our news service, Coverage, received a Gold Stevie award for its website and a Silver Stevie award for its COVID-19 communications campaign in the 2020 International Business Awards competition, the world’s premier business awards program.
The National Committee for Quality Assurance has awarded an accreditation status of Accredited to our commercial HMO/POS and commercial PPO products for service and clinical quality that meet the requirements of NCQA's rigorous standards for consumer protection and quality improvement.
The National Committee for Quality Assurance (NCQA) has named us one of the highest-rated health plans in the country for quality in their Health Insurance Plan Ratings for 2019-2020*. We are in the top 10 percent of U.S. health plans for quality. NCQA awarded Blue Cross' Commercial HMO/POS plan and Commercial PPO plan a rating of 4.5 out of 5.
*Due to COVID-19, NCQA will not rate health plans for 2020-2021. Plans are permitted to use their 2019-2020 Health Plan Rating score
Highest in Member Satisfaction among Commercial Health Plans in Massachusetts
For the fourth year in a row, J.D. Power ranked us #1 in member satisfaction among all commercial health plans in Massachusetts. In 2020, we achieved the highest score for coverage and benefits, provider choice, information and communication, and billing and payment.

Medicare Prescription Drug Plan Quality Award
The Pharmacy Quality Alliance (PQA) recognized our Medicare Prescription Drug Plan with a quality award for high achievement on PQA measures of medication safety and appropriate use. The awards are based on published CMS Medicare Part D Star Ratings. PQA is the nation’s leading developer of consensus-based measures for medication safety, adherence and appropriate use.

We received the prestigious Brand Innovation Award from the Blue Cross Blue Shield Association for our ongoing work to combat the opioid epidemic.
We were recognized for creating a series of groundbreaking programs that expand access to care, engage employers in the prevention of overdoses, and provide education and other resources that support people with opioid use disorder through treatment and recovery while reducing the stigma associated with opioid use.

Information Security
We're proud to announce that our main systems processing, hosting and exchanging of members' personal health information have earned Certified status again for information security by the Health Information Trust (HITRUST) Alliance. This two-year certification validates our commitment to protecting our members' sensitive private health care information.
